If a mutation occurs in a sex cell, then it may be inherited. Any mutation to the somatic cells will not be passed on.
An inherited mutation is a mutation that gets passed through the genes. Two examples are achondroplasia (dwarfism) or hemophilia (where your blood loses its ability to clot)

A mutation occurring in a germ cell is heritable 50% of the time. Somatic cell mutations only affect the individual cell and its progeny produced by mitosis. Somatic cell mutations cannot be passed on to the organism's offspring.

Mutations in sex cells are more serious because they are heritable and affect the next generation. Remember, though, that mutations in somatic cells can cause cancer and tumors but are non- heritable.

Mutations are able to be inherited if they occur in your mother or father's sex cells. This is known as a germline mutation.
